The Ethiopian government has implemented various policies related to the endotracheal tube market to ensure quality standards and safety for medical devices. The Ethiopian Food and Drug Administration (EFDA) regulates the registration, importation, and distribution of medical devices, including endotracheal tubes, to ensure compliance with quality standards and patient safety. Additionally, the government has established guidelines for healthcare facilities to follow in the procurement and use of medical devices, including endotracheal tubes, to improve the overall healthcare system in the country. These policies aim to enhance the availability of quality medical devices in Ethiopia and promote better healthcare outcomes for the population.
